To commemorate its 15th anniversary, hospitality interiors purchasing company the Carroll Adams Group hosted a charity golf tournament last month at the Dubsdread Golf Course in Orlando. Proceeds from the event benefitted the Coalition for the Homeless of Central Florida as well as Project Appalachia at the Benedictine Grange, which provides aid to Virginia and Kentucky residents living in poverty.

Carroll first launched the brand in 2001 following an in-house purchasing role. The Carroll Adams Group has since worked on projects for some of the industry’s top names like Ritz-Carlton, Hilton Orlando, and the Westin New York at Times Square. It currently comprises nearly 50 employees in across its offices in New York, Chicago, and Orlando.
